Different tools offer various approaches to unlocking Android phones. Some rely on bypassing security measures, while others concentrate on more secure methods. Understanding these approaches can help you determine which tool is most suitable for your situation.
- Unlocking via Google Account: This is a common method for recovering access to your phone. If you have a valid Google account linked to your device, you can often regain control by resetting the device through Google’s recovery process. This approach is particularly helpful if you’ve forgotten your password or have lost access to your device. The advantage is its relative ease and security, relying on established Google infrastructure.
The disadvantage lies in the necessity of having previously set up and linked a Google account. This method is not applicable in scenarios where the Google account is also inaccessible.
